IMO we are very solid at LB now. Big upgrade in speed and athleticism. Here is my view:
2018: Patrick Joyner (Forgotten man. Dude is big enough to plug the middle, set the edge and plenty fast enough to get wide)
2019: Brooks and Huff (Both have Size and Speed and Star potential)
2020: Cave (Speed/aggressive), Flagg and Keshaun Washington ( I believe he will be a Striker or outright LB, more speed)
2021: Troutman (prototypical fast new era LB) , Tyler Johnson (good size fast agressive), Hammett (great at rushing the QB), Thomas Brown (hybrid LB/DE with good size, fast and versatile) and I'll add James Wms (fast, can be used at SS/FS, Striker, Rush End/Edge Blitzer and Middle Blitzer)

Keshawn Washington is rail thin and was playing safety in the few practices we saw in spring
Looking at our last couple classes under Manny - our RB, WR, TE, OL, DL and safety recruiting has been elite.
CB has been underwhelming and QB is incomplete (even though I really like TVD).
LB seems to have been talented guys that are underrated. I think that an ELITE LB and CB is what’s missing from the D.
Troutman is a beast. Just went through his highlights (15 mins!)
He has elite closing speed, instincts and tackling ability.
Brooks, Huff, TAC and Troutman seem to have the best physical traits.
Flagg is a great football player - his instincts make up for his lack of speed/size.
Can anyone that has seen Tyler Johnson or Hammett assess their projections as off the ball linebackers? Their highlights are mainly as Rush Ends.
While I really would like Lewis to be in the class (depending on what the full story is) I think that we have some high upside players already.
